Bose-Einstein condensation of scalar fields on hyperbolic manifolds
arXiv:hep-th/9210003 · doi:10.1103/PhysRevD.47.4575
Abstract
The problem of Bose-Einstein condensation for a relativistic ideal gas on a 3+1 dimensional manifold with a hyperbolic spatial part is analyzed in some detail. The critical temperature is evaluated and its dependence of curvature is pointed out.
